I have got the complete vb6 application for doing graphic and costing estimation. I am currently using microsoft access database.

The problem is: my client is currently using a quickbook application for their accounting package (for paying employees, suppliers and making an invoice for the customer).

As far as I concern, I need to access the item and pricing information in visual basic, so they can use my program without any data redundancy. Furthermore, I need to insert some data into quickbook table.

There is no need for quickbook and vb6 to join into one single program. But I want them to share the same data / database.

What should I do?
